Kinds Of Bunk Beds
Before making a choice, it's vital to comprehend the numerous types of bunk beds offered:
1. Twin Over Twin
The traditional twin over twin setup is the most common. learn more works well in little areas and is ideal for siblings sharing a space.
2. Twin Over Full
This alternative uses an extra sleeping space with a full-size bed on the bottom. It's perfect for older brother or sisters, slumber parties, or visitors.
3. L-Shaped Bunk Beds
These bunk beds are created in an L-shape, providing unique layouts that can suit corners, making them space-efficient while supplying more room underneath the lower bunk for storage or play.
4. Loft Beds
Loft beds elevate the bed mattress frame completely, leaving space beneath for a desk, dresser, or play area. This design is particularly useful for older kids who desire to maximize their room.
5. Bunk Beds with Integrated Storage
Numerous contemporary bunk beds feature drawers, shelves, or desks built-in, making them an outstanding choice for keeping rooms neat and organized.
6. Triple Bunk Beds
For larger households or sleepover lovers, triple bunk beds stack 3 beds vertically, optimizing sleeping space while reducing the footprint.

Safety Considerations
While bunk beds can be a great addition to any space, security is critical. Here are some crucial security factors to consider:
- Guardrails: Ensure the top bunk has guardrails on all sides to avoid falls.
- Weight Limit: Adhere to the maker's weight guidelines.
- Appropriate Assembly: Follow assembly instructions thoroughly; loose screws and joints can result in instability.
- Age Appropriateness: Most manufacturers recommend that children under six years of ages need to not oversleep the leading bunk.
- Ladder Safety: Make sure the ladder is stable; kids must be taught how to utilize it securely.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: At what age is it safe for my child to oversleep the top bunk?
It's normally recommended that children under six years old need to not oversleep the leading bunk due to the threat of falling.
Q2: Can bunk beds be separated into two beds?
Many bunk beds are created to be quickly separated into two private beds. Always check the item requirements.
Q3: How do I keep my bunk bed?
Routinely inspect for loose screws and bolts, avoid extreme leaping on the beds, and tidy them with proper furnishings cleaners to preserve their appearance.
Q4: How can I take full advantage of storage with a bunk bed?
Select models with integrated drawers, and consider under-bed storage solutions like bins or boxes to keep the space organized.
Q5: Are there any weight constraints for bunk beds?
Yes, each bunk bed has a weight limit that should be strictly followed to guarantee security. Constantly check the maker's requirements.
